langshan

/ˈlæŋʃæn/
noun
  1. A breed of large domestic chicken originally from China, known for its black feathers, white skin, and good egg-laying ability.
    • The Langshan chicken is prized for its dark plumage and calm temperament.
    • We added three Langshan hens to our flock because they lay large brown eggs.
    • At the county fair, the Langshan rooster won first prize for its beautiful feathers.
